Understanding the Swagtron E-Bike Lineup

Swagtron’s e-bike portfolio is characterized by its variety. To truly assess their worth, it’s crucial to understand the different types of e-bikes they offer. Here’s a breakdown of some popular categories:

Foldable E-Bikes: Urban Mobility Redefined

Foldable e-bikes are a cornerstone of Swagtron’s offerings, designed for city dwellers and commuters who need a bike that’s both portable and practical. Models like the Swagtron EB5 Pro and EB7 Plus exemplify this category.

These bikes are engineered for easy storage and transportation. Imagine folding your e-bike and carrying it onto a train or storing it neatly in a small apartment. Features often include:

  • Compact Folding Mechanisms: Allowing for quick and easy folding for storage in tight spaces.
  • Lightweight Frames: Enhancing portability without compromising durability.
  • Sufficient Battery Range: Providing enough power for typical urban commutes and errands.

However, foldable e-bikes may have smaller wheels and less powerful motors compared to their full-sized counterparts, which is something to consider depending on your riding needs and terrain.

Commuter E-Bikes: Effortless Daily Rides

For those seeking a reliable and comfortable ride for daily commutes, Swagtron offers a range of commuter e-bikes. These models prioritize comfort, range, and practicality for navigating city streets and bike paths.

Commuter e-bikes often boast features such as:

  • Comfortable Upright Riding Posture: Reducing strain on the back and wrists during longer rides.
  • Integrated Lights and Fenders: Enhancing safety and practicality for all-weather commuting.
  • Longer Battery Range Options: Suitable for longer commutes and extended use throughout the day.

While commuter e-bikes are excellent for paved surfaces, they might not be as equipped for rougher terrains or off-road adventures.

Off-Road/Mountain E-Bikes: Adventure Unleashed

Swagtron also ventures into the realm of off-road e-bikes, catering to riders who crave adventure and exploration beyond paved roads. These models are built to handle challenging terrains and provide the extra power needed for uphill climbs and rugged trails.

Key features of Swagtron off-road e-bikes typically include:

  • Front or Full Suspension Systems: Absorbing shocks and bumps for a smoother ride on uneven surfaces.
  • Powerful Motors: Providing ample torque for tackling steep inclines and challenging trails.
  • Durable Frames and Components: Built to withstand the rigors of off-road riding.

Keep in mind that off-road e-bikes might be heavier and less portable than other types, and their battery range can be affected by demanding terrain.

Key Features and Technologies of Swagtron E-Bikes

Beyond the different categories, Swagtron e-bikes share several common features and technologies that define their appeal.

  • Electric Pedal Assist and Throttle: Swagtron e-bikes typically offer both pedal assist, which provides motorized assistance when you pedal, and throttle mode, allowing you to propel the bike without pedaling. This versatility caters to different riding preferences and situations.
  • Removable Batteries: Many Swagtron e-bikes feature removable batteries, offering convenience for charging and storage. This also allows for the possibility of purchasing extra batteries for extended range.
  • Digital Displays: Most models are equipped with digital displays that show essential information such as speed, battery level, pedal assist level, and distance traveled.
  • Integrated Lights: For enhanced safety, many Swagtron e-bikes come with integrated front and rear lights, improving visibility in low-light conditions.

Pros and Cons of Swagtron E-Bikes

To provide a balanced perspective, let’s weigh the advantages and disadvantages of choosing a Swagtron e-bike.

Pros:

  • Affordability: Swagtron e-bikes are generally positioned as more budget-friendly compared to some premium e-bike brands, making them accessible to a wider range of consumers.
  • Variety of Models: The diverse lineup ensures that there’s likely a Swagtron e-bike to suit various needs, from commuting to off-road riding.
  • Foldable Options: Their foldable e-bikes are a standout feature, offering exceptional portability for urban environments.
  • User-Friendly Features: Features like pedal assist, throttle, removable batteries, and digital displays enhance the overall riding experience and convenience.

Cons:

  • Component Quality: To maintain affordability, some Swagtron e-bikes might use slightly lower-grade components compared to higher-end brands. This could potentially impact long-term durability and performance, especially under heavy use.
  • Motor and Battery Performance: While adequate for many riders, the motor power and battery range of some Swagtron models might not match the performance of more expensive e-bikes, particularly for demanding terrains or very long distances.
  • Brand Reputation: While Swagtron is gaining recognition, it may not have the same long-standing reputation as some established bicycle brands.
